My favorites are all "generic" (as in, not unique) magical weapons: Flying daggers from the first Ruins of Undermountain boxed set, dragonfang daggers from Dragon 169, and gemswords from SJR1 Lost Ships.

Interestingly, all of those come from Ed's pen.

I like Thunderstaves as written up in Volo's Guide to All Things Magical. I also liked Ilbratha, Mistress of Battles, from The Magister. It wasn't any mighty artifact but it had a history and some interesting powers to go along with it's +1 to hit and damage.

Arilyn's moonblade was also a cool idea I thought when I read about it. I liked that the sword gained powers from it's wielders, that they had to sacrifice to hold one, and that even trying to claim one was a risky proposition for an elf since they could be judged unfit and die by the blade they hoped to claim.
